ANAMBRA POLICE RECORD FURTHER BREAKTHROUGH IN OGIDI, RECOVER MORE ARMS. (PHOTO). #PRESS RELEASE.

Image
 BREAKING NEWS ANAMBRA POLICE RECORD FURTHER BREAKTHROUGH IN OGIDI, RECOVER MORE ARMS In continuation of an earlier operation by Operatives of the Rapid Response Squad, Awkuzu, which led to the arrest of three suspects and recovery of arms in Ogidi on 21st March 2026, the Anambra State Police Command has recorded further breakthrough following sustained investigation and interrogation. The Operatives made additional progress with the arrest of the suspected ringleader of the syndicate, one Chukwuka Anene ‘M’, aged 46 years, who confessed to being the armourer of the gang. The suspect subsequently led Police operatives to the gang’s hideout in Ogidi, where the following items were recovered: two pump-action guns, two locally made Beretta pistols, five rounds of 9mm ammunition, seven live cartridges, a beret linked to a cult group, and body armour. BORNO PAYS ₦529.7M WASSCE FEES FOR 26,000 STUDENTS. (PHOTO).


 Borno Pays ₦529.7m WASSCE Fees for 26,000 Students


The Borno State Government has paid ₦529.7 million to cover 2025 WASSCE fees for 26,158 final-year students in public schools. 


Commissioner for Education, Lawan Wakilbe, said the move reflects Governor Zulum’s commitment to inclusive education. Since 2019, the state has spent over ₦4.1 billion on exam fees for 165,442 students. WAEC praised the state’s efforts, noting improved access and reduced out-of-school children despite security challenges.
